Pearl River Superintendent Reacts to Connecticut Shooting

Dr. John Morgano expressed his sadness regarding the tragic shooting that left 27 people dead at Sandy Hook Elementary School in Newtown, Ct.

Pearl River Superintendent of Schools Dr. John Morgano spoke of  the Newtown, Ct. community in his reaction to the fatal shootings at Sandy Hook Elementary School Friday that left 27 people dead, 20 of them children.

"We are deeply saddened by the tragic events that took place this morning in Sandy Hook Elementary School," Morgano said. "Our thoughts and prayers are with the students, their families,  faculty and staff, and the community of Newtown."
